UNBLEMISHED INFOTECH (OPC) PRIVATE LIMITED

SEARCH

Feel free to reach out to us!

    Where are we located?

    HOUSE NO. 301B PKT-B-04, KESHAVPURAM, KESHAVPURAM, North Delhi, Delhi, 110035

    Back to Top